Hydraulic products under Bosch Rexroth can generally be divided into three categories: Rexroth piston pumps, Rexroth vane pumps, and Rexroth gear pumps. In terms of appearance, the Rexroth gear pump differs significantly from the first two types. We can analyze the differences by examining a sample of the Rexroth gear pump. Below are samples of three different types of Rexroth gear pumps:Rexroth PGH 3X fixed-displacement gear pump
Model series: PGH 3X
Model specifications available: 4, 5
Component series: 3X
Maximum operating pressure: 350 bar
Displacement: 020–250 cm³;
– Fixed displacement
– Low operating noise
– Low flow pulsation
– High efficiency even at low speeds and with low-viscosity fluids, thanks to seal clearance compensation
– Suitable for a wide range of viscosities and speeds
– All frame sizes and specifications can be combined in any way
– Can be used in combination with internal gear pumps, vane pumps, and axial piston pumps
Rexroth PGH 2X series gear pump
Model series: PGH 2X
Model specifications available: 2, 3, 4, 5
Component series: 2X
Maximum operating pressure: 350 bar
Displacement: 005–250 cm³;
– Fixed displacement
– Low operating noise
– Low flow pulsation
– High efficiency even at low speeds and with low-viscosity fluids, thanks to seal clearance compensation
– Suitable for a wide range of viscosities and speeds
– All model specifications and displacement values can be combined with each other
Rexroth PGF 1X series gear pump
■ Fixed displacement
■ Frame sizes: 1, 2, and 3
■ Component series: 2X and 3X
■ Maximum operating pressure: 250 bar
■ Maximum displacement volume: 1.7 to 40 cm³;
